nm = deg2nm(deg)
converts distances from degrees to nautical miles, as measured along a great circle
on a sphere with a radius of 3440.065 nautical miles, the mean radius of the
Earth.
nm = deg2nm(deg,radius)
converts distances from degrees to nautical miles, as measured along a great circle
on a sphere having the specified radius.
nm = deg2nm(deg,sphere)
converts distances from degrees to nautical miles, as measured along a great circle
on a sphere approximating an object in the Solar System.
Distance in degrees, specified as a numeric array.
Data Types: single | double
Radius of sphere in units of nautical miles, specified as a numeric scalar.
Sphere approximating an object in the Solar System, specified as one of the following
values: 'sun', 'moon',
'mercury', 'venus',
'earth', 'mars', 'jupiter',
'saturn', 'uranus',
'neptune', or 'pluto'. The value of
sphere is case-insensitive.
